Transaction 12803366ee4e114cec3fcf9056758ccefa6e800ebc53a3f6ca345fdb05d6f1f7
2 Input
2 Outputs
- 12803366ee4e114cec3fcf9056758ccefa6e800ebc53a3f6ca345fdb05d6f1f7:0
- 12803366ee4e114cec3fcf9056758ccefa6e800ebc53a3f6ca345fdb05d6f1f7:1
value 997533
address 1EbwhgzvFSoHbjzi9GXuAQ1DwWk32EhNBX
value 700000
address 3Ph1ghKfjXmMwhgbzN9XkUBpRMYdpePPmL